What is the difference between Coordinator Hospital Risk vs Risk Management Specialist?
| Aspect | Coordinator Hospital Risk | Risk Management Specialist |
|---|---|---|
| Credentials | Often requires a bachelor's degree in healthcare, risk management, or related field | Typically requires a bachelor's degree, with some roles preferring certifications like ARM or CRM |
| Work Environment | Hospitals, healthcare facilities, risk management departments | Healthcare organizations, insurance companies, consulting firms |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Used within hospital settings to coordinate risk mitigation efforts | Broader use across industries, focusing on risk analysis and mitigation strategies |
The Coordinator Hospital Risk primarily focuses on coordinating risk management activities within hospitals, ensuring compliance and safety protocols. In contrast, a Risk Management Specialist often works across various industries, analyzing risks and developing mitigation strategies. While both roles require similar educational backgrounds and certifications, their work environments and scope differ, with the coordinator being more hospital-specific and the specialist having a broader industry application.

Job Summary
Quality Program Coordinator supports the planning, coordination, and evaluation of quality improvement initiatives, ensuring compliance with healthcare regulations while analyzing data, tracking performance, and aligning projects with organizational goals. It also serves as the hospital's Patient Family Relations lead, managing complaints and grievances, facilitating communication across teams, and promoting patient-centered care, safety, and continuous improvement.
Qualifications
The Quality Program Coordinator role is responsible for supporting the planning, implementation, and monitoring of quality improvement projects. This role involves coordinating various quality initiatives, managing project timelines, and ensuring compliance with healthcare standards and regulations while working closely with clinical and administrative teams to enhance patient care quality, safety, and operational efficiency. The Quality Program Coordinator also functions as hospital's Patient Family Relations (PFR) lead, responding to patient and family complaints and grievances in accordance with regulations.
Essential Functions
- Assists in the planning and execution of quality improvement projects, ensuring alignment with organizational goals and objectives. Coordinates project activities, including scheduling meetings, preparing agendas, and maintaining project documentation.
- Monitors project progress against timelines and deliverables, identifying and addressing any issues or delays.
- Collects, organizes, and analyzes data related to quality measures, patient outcomes, and performance metrics. Supports the development of reports, dashboards, and presentations to communicate project progress and results to stakeholders.
- Serves as a liaison between project teams, clinical staff, and leadership to facilitate communication and ensure project alignment with departmental needs.
- Ensures that quality projects adhere to relevant regulatory requirements and accreditation standards.
- Assists in the preparation of regulatory surveys and audits by compiling necessary documentation and evidence of compliance. Stays informed about changes in healthcare regulations and standards that may impact quality projects.
- Tracks the effectiveness of implemented changes and makes recommendations for further improvements.
- Coordinates hospital's Policy Leadership Committee and is lead for Policy Management system.
- Works with patients, families and hospital leadership in acknowledging and responding to patient family complaints in a compassionate, supportive and timely manner.
- Prepares formal correspondence and documentation (both patient-facing and internal), such as letters, messages, and reports, with efficiency and accuracy.
- Fosters teamwork and partnerships between hospital staff, physicians, and department leaders, Quality, Risk, and Compliance to ensure responses are patient/family-centric.
- Provides telephone coverage and in-person support of patient and family relations for patients' and loved ones' needs, concerns, or complaints. Conducts rounds with patients, families, and visitors to obtain preemptive feedback regarding the inpatient hospital experience (when appropriate and aligned with hospital safety policies).
- Functions as the civil rights coordinator in receiving and coordinating follow-ups on any civil rights or health equity complaints.
- Documents information regarding patient and/or staff concerns and requests in a confidential department database and disseminates data to appropriate leadership staff for quality assurance purposes.
- Maintains organized and accurate project documentation, including plans, timelines, meeting minutes, and action items.
